Royston and Lund are pleased to market this beautiful equestrian property nestled within a village in the heart of the countryside on the borders of Nottinghamshire/Leicestershire. Offered to the market with no onward chain.

The property comprises versatile residential and equestrian accommodation in the form of a detached cottage, a selection of outbuildings, hard standing for a garage, three brick-built stables with adjoining secure tack room, two additional timber stables, and a large timber hay barn and storage building, a timber framed log store, tractor store and storage area. An all-weather turnout area with field shelter, a professionally built 20 x 40 ménage and a post & rail fenced paddock with a field shelter add to the equestrian facilities. There is also the possibility to rent further grazing (by separate negotiation), located next door, with an access gate from the stable area.

Entering into the property there is the first of three reception rooms, which then leads through to an inner hallway with under-stairs storage. The lounge benefits from windows to the front and rear and a lovely exposed brick fireplace with log burner. Moving towards the rear you enter the kitchen that benefits from a Rayburn oven that runs the central heating, an electric oven, hob, extractor fan and dishwasher.

From the kitchen there is access to the rear lobby that benefits from a downstairs WC and leads to both the boot room and the dining room that features a further log burner, vaulted ceiling and a bay window to the side. From the dining room there is access to a large ground floor bedroom which has an en-suite shower room and its own external entrance. This are room could be used for a dependent relative, staff accommodation or a B&B, for which it has a track record.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
